I decided to test this track 7 theory myself, for fun, on entirely random
CD selections.
Artist: Biosphere
Album: SubStrata
Track 7: "Kobresia"
Certainly works here. My favorite track on this incredible album.
Artist: Orbital
Album: Orbital 2 (the brown album)
Track 7: "Walk Now"
Definitely a decent track, to be sure, but doesn't really come close to
the epic "Halcton + On + On" or the various "Lush" interpretations.
Artist: Autechre
Album: LP5
Track 7: "Under BOAC"
I'll probably start another Ae flame war with this, but I find this track
wholly annoying. Doesn't touch the track following it, "corc," for
unrivaled beauty.
Artist: Various
Album: Vibon compilation
Track 7: "Cootchie" by Flowchart
Oh, Hell no. The standout here is definitely track 9, "Strung Out" by
Spintronic; melodic, SAW1 style beaty goodness.
Artist: Global Communication
Album: Pentamerous Metamorphosis
Track 7: n/a
Well, what the Hell do I do here? Go find a copy of "Blood Music" and
try to guess which of the phases is an interpretation of "On the Way to
Fly?"
Artist: Kid Spatula
Album: Spatula Freak
Track 7: "Get Up T"
No, sir, nothing touches "Cough" (track 5).
Artist: Exterior Mirror
Album: Hupp
Track 7: "Coolant"
Definitely, definitely. This is one of the better post SAW2 textural
albums I've heard, and "Coolant" is the climax.
Artist: Scorn
Album: Logghi Barogghi
Track 7: "Logghi Barogghi"
No arguement that it's certainly the title track. Decently composed, but
way to short to be a standout. Check "Out Of" (track 5) instead
for menacing clip-hop ("clip" as in "distorted to fuck").
Artist: Squarepusher
Album: Hard Normal Daddy
Track 7: "E8 Boogie"
Lots of jazzy fun here, but certainly not the one that makes me sit up and
go "whoa, shit." That honor falls to track 2: "Beep Street"
Artist: The Orb
Album: The Orb's Adventures Beyond the Ultraworld (original US single-CD
version)
Track 7: "Star 6 & 7 8 9"
Are you kidding? This is the one track I *don't* like off of
this! "Outlands" (track 6) and "Earth (Gaia)" (track 2) wipe the floor
with it.
So, out of ten discs: 2 positive votes, 7 negative votes, and one
inapplicable. I discovered as many positive votes for tracks 2, 5 and 9
globally. One might note that the selection sample is pathetically small
for any statistical analysis; one might just as well note that 2 plus 5
and 9 minus 2 both equal 7. Like I said, it's all just for fun.
